Police investigate suspicious death on Kmart parcel

Ceres Police are investigating the suspicious cause of death of woman whose body was found Saturday morning near a bush at the northwest area of the Kmart parking lot.

The body of Clara Wiley, 47, was found by a store employee. Reportedly a transient, Wiley was found lying face up on the ground and reported to police at 8:20 a.m. The woman appeared to have been dead for quite some time.

Initially officers suggested there were no signs of foul play and no signs of a struggle or visible injuries. However, the Sheriff’s Coroner office conducted an autopsy and suggested Wiley may have died under suspicious circumstances with internal and some external signs of being run over by a large truck, possibly a tractor-trailer rig while she was lying down in the parking lot.

The case is being investigated by Ceres Police detectives. They are hoping anyone with information or knowledge about the woman or her death will call Officer Kessler at 538-5620, or call the Crime Stoppers line at 521-4636.
